What is an Integrated Cooker?
An integrated cooker is a compact cooking home appliance that integrates several cooking functions into one system. Frequently built into kitchen cabinetry, these cookers are designed to conserve area while boosting kitchen aesthetic appeals. They typically integrate a variety of performances, such as baking, barbecuing, steaming, and even pressure cooking.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. What is the average price of an integrated cooker?
The price of integrated cookers can vary extensively, usually varying from ₤ 500 to ₤ 3,000 depending on functions, brand, and size.
2. Just how much upkeep do integrated cookers need?
Maintenance often consists of routine cleansing of surfaces and looking for any software application updates if they feature clever innovation. It's advisable to follow the producer's guidelines.
3. Can I replace my existing oven with an integrated cooker?
Yes, integrated cookers can typically change standard ovens, but it is essential to talk to an expert to ensure compatibility with your kitchen design.
4. Are integrated cookers tough to set up?
Setup can be simple for those with DIY experience. Nevertheless, hiring a qualified professional is suggested to ensure appropriate setup.
5. Who benefits most from utilizing an integrated cooker?
Families, time-pressed people, and those living in compact houses especially benefit from the multi-functionality and space-saving style of integrated cookers.
